Jerry Ropelato is the CEO of a technology and entertainment review Web site, www.TopTenREVIEWS.com. TopTenREVIEWS has published a review of each state's sex offender registry Web site, providing customers with a ranking of the Web sites overall and the benefits each site brings to its users, such as information provided, search functions, ease of use and features provided. Missouri, Alabama and Florida are the top three state sites in the review. The complete review can be found at http://sex-offender-registry-review.toptenreviews.com. Addie Swartz is the founder and CEO of B*tween Productions, Inc, home of the Beacon Street Girls award-winning book series and COPPA-compliant (Children's Online Privacy and Protection Act) website for preteen girls (www.beaconstreetgirls.com). Addie created the Beacon Street Girls in 2002 to provide positive media and healthy role models for tween girls. Today, there are twelve Beacon Street Girls books with more 450,000 copies in print. The company has "super-fans" in 95 countries and the books are available through leading book stores and online. Recently the company released a new book, Just Kidding, which addresses cyber-bullying and Internet safety. The company worked with the Internet Keep Safe Coalition, (www.ikeepsafe.org) a non-profit organization dedicated to teaching children the safe and healthy use of technology and the Internet; bestselling author Rachel Simmons (Odd Girl Out: The Hidden Culture of Aggression in Girls); Rob Nickel, president, Kid Innovation Canada, a 14-year veteran of the Ontario Provincial Police and a former Detective Sergeant with the OPP's Child Pornography Section and; the Internet Safety Program Coordinator, Office of the Attorney General of Massachusetts.
